The ACCUPRO 314729 is a solid carbide square end mill designed for precision material removal in milling operations. It features a 3/8-inch diameter, a 3-flute geometry, and a 37-degree helix angle for efficient chip evacuation and smooth cutting performance. The cutting edges are coated with ZrN (zirconium nitride), which improves wear resistance and extends tool life in ferrous and non-ferrous applications. The micrograin carbide substrate provides rigidity and edge retention under demanding cutting conditions. This end mill is center-cutting and designed for single-end use, making it appropriate for plunge entry and multi-axis contouring work. It is typically installed and used by machinists and tool-and-die professionals in CNC and manual milling environments.
This end mill suits general-purpose milling tasks in shop and production settings, including slotting, profiling, and contouring. The right-hand cutting and right-hand spiral flute configuration is standard for conventional CNC machining center spindles. With a 3/4-inch length of cut and a 2-1/2-inch overall length, it fits a range of standard toolholders accepting a 3/8-inch shank diameter. This end mill is installed by machinists using a compatible collet or end mill holder rated for 3/8-inch shanks. Ensure the machine spindle is fully stopped and locked before inserting or removing the tool. Verify runout with a dial indicator after seating to confirm proper tool engagement. Follow the machine manufacturer and cutting tool manufacturer guidelines for feeds, speeds, and depth of cut appropriate to the workpiece material.
